Carrier-locked Galaxy A53 5G getting August 2023 update in the US

After distributing the August 2023 update to several flagship devices, US carriers are now expanding the update to mid-range smartphones, like the Galaxy A53, which is now receiving the new update.

Notably, the new update for the Galaxy A53 is now rolling out for the carrier-locked variant; the update is now available on four carriers, including Dish Wireless, T-Mobile, MetroPCS, and Xfinity Mobile. It is worth noticing that the unlocked variant of the device has already received the update.

Users who are using the Galaxy A53 5G device, which is affiliated with Xfinity Mobile, can identify the latest update by the firmware version number A536USQS7CWGA, while on other carriers, the device is grabbing the same update with a different version number, A536USQS7CWG9.

The August 2023 update doesn’t bring any innovation to the device, but it does bring some improvements to its security. According to the official documentation, the update will address over 80 security vulnerabilities and enhance the security mechanisms of Galaxy devices.


The Galaxy A53 5G was launched in 2022. It comes with Android 12. Later, the device received a major update in the form of Android 13. Samsung has promised to release at least four major updates and some minor updates every five years. So devices will be eligible to get new updates until 2027.
